Italian
Etymology
Borrowed from French pantalon, from Italian Pantalone, name of a Venetian traditional character.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/pan.taˈlo.ne/
Audio (file) - Rhymes: -one
- Hyphenation: pan‧ta‧ló‧ne
Noun
pantalone m (plural pantaloni, diminutive pantaloncìni, pejorative pantalonàcci)
- (usually in the plural) trousers; trouser suit
